* [PATCH] arm64: dts: qcom: sc7180: Fix sc7180-qmp-usb3-dp-phy reg sizes

As per Dmitry Baryshkov [1]:
a) The 2nd "reg" should be 0x3c because "Offset 0x38 is
   USB3_DP_COM_REVISION_ID3 (not used by the current driver though)."
b) The 3rd "reg" "is a serdes region and qmp_v3_dp_serdes_tbl contains
   registers 0x148 and 0x154."

I think because the 3rd "reg" is a serdes region we should just use
the same size as the 1st "reg"?

di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7180.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7180.dtsi
index 83fbb481cae5..61732e5efe62 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7180.dtsi
+++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7180.dtsi
@@ -2754,8 +2754,8 @@ usb_1_hsphy: phy@88e3000 {
 		usb_1_qmpphy: phy-wrapper@88e9000 {
 			compatible = "qcom,sc7180-qmp-usb3-dp-phy";
 			reg = <0 0x088e9000 0 0x18c>,
-			      <0 0x088e8000 0 0x38>,
-			      <0 0x088ea000 0 0x40>;
+			      <0 0x088e8000 0 0x3c>,
+			      <0 0x088ea000 0 0x18c>;
 			status = "disabled";
 			#address-cells = <2>;
 			#size-cells = <2>;
